Top 10 Best Central City Public Middle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 12 public middle schools serving 5,027 students in the neighborhood of Central City, Phoenix, AZ.
The top ranked public middle schools in Central City are Arizona School For The Arts, Amerischools Academy - Yuma and Capitol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Central City, Phoenix, AZ public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 11% (versus the Arizona public middle school average of 33%), and reading proficiency score of 23% (versus the 40%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 88%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Arizona public middle school average of 65% (majority Hispanic).
